Basic Concepts of Square Keys
Square keys are mechanical fasteners used to connect rotating machine elements and prevent relative motion between them. They fit into matching square holes in both the shaft and the hub, ensuring that the two components rotate together as a single unit. In the automotive industry, square keys are commonly employed in applications requiring precise alignment and torque transmission, such as in engine and transmission assemblies 1.

Role of Part 4900230 Square Key in Engine Systems
In the orchestration of engine components, the 4900230 Square Key assumes a significant role in ensuring the seamless interaction between various parts. This square key is instrumental in maintaining the alignment and synchronization of the camshaft and crankshaft, which are pivotal for the engine’s operation.
The camshaft, a component that controls the opening and closing of the engine’s valves, relies on precise timing to function effectively. The 4900230 Square Key aids in this by securing the camshaft in place, allowing it to rotate in unison with the crankshaft. This synchronization is important for the engine’s valves to open and close at the correct moments in the engine cycle.
Similarly, the crankshaft, which converts the reciprocating motion of the pistons into rotational motion, must also be in perfect harmony with other engine components. The square key ensures that the crankshaft pulley, which is connected to the crankshaft, rotates smoothly and without deviation. This is particularly important for the crankshaft pulley, as it drives the engine’s accessory belt, powering components such as the alternator and water pump.
Furthermore, the square key’s role extends to the engine crankshaft itself. By providing a secure fit, it prevents any lateral movement that could lead to misalignment. This is vital for the durability and efficiency of the engine, as any misalignment could result in increased wear and potential failure of the crankshaft or connected components.
